Summary

Join Pathpoint, the first fully digital wholesale broker, as a detail-oriented Financial Operations Analyst to support our Financial Operations Manager in insourcing and optimizing core finance and accounting processes. This role will involve collaborating across multiple departments to ensure smooth financial operations, assist with monthly reconciliations, and improve process efficiencies.

Requirements

  • 2-4 Years of Experience: Previous experience in financial operations, accounting, or a related field, preferably in an insurance brokerage, large agency, or fast-growth environment
  • Attention to Detail: Strong attention to detail and accuracy in handling financial data and processes
  • Technical Skills: Proficiency in QuickBooks Online, Microsoft Excel. Experience with Salesforce or other CRM platforms is a plus
  • Analytical Mindset: Ability to analyze financial data, identify trends, and provide actionable insights to improve processes
  • Self-Starter: Ability to work independently and take initiative in improving existing processes and workflows
  • Collaboration: Strong communication skills and the ability to work effectively with cross-functional teams

Responsibilities

  • Assist management in the preparation and reconciliation of agency receivables, vendor payables, and monthly carrier payables, ensuring timely and accurate reporting
  • Support the processing of unreconciled Ascend wire payments to ensure proper allocation and reconciliation
  • Assist in logging monthly carrier payables in Novidea, and review and process backlog payables in Salesforce for the current year
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ams to reconcile carrier and Salesforce data. Create and document workflows for the monthly payment process, ensuring accuracy after payments are disbursed
  • Support senior management in the daily, weekly, and monthly reconciliation of past-due warning accounts for carriers
  • Assist with reconciling outstanding items in Novidea, including policies with unapproved transactions, to ensure accurate financial records
  • Participate in special projects, such as internal audits and ad-hoc assignments, as required by senior management
  • Provide back-up support to the Finance Manager and team, promoting continuous quality improvement in all finance operations
  • Apply new technical accounting guidelines to work processes and develop exception reporting and reconciliation procedures to manage high transaction volumes efficiently
